Production Costs
The total expenses incurred in manufacturing a product or offering a service, including raw materials, labor, and overhead.
Consumer Income
The total amount of income a consumer or household earns from various sources, including employment, investments, and benefits, which impacts their spending and saving behaviors.
Demand Curve
A graph showing the relationship between the price of a good and the quantity demanded at those prices.
